Family sues Spirit Airlines after dementia patient left unattended at airport and dies

The Osorio family filed a federal lawsuit in Houston accusing Spirit Airlines of abandoning 75-year-old Marcos Humberto Vindel Osorio, who had mild dementia, by failing to provide promised deplaning and airport assistance; Osorio reportedly wandered from George Bush Intercontinental Airport onto the Eastex Freeway and was struck by vehicles. The lawsuit claims Spirit’s lack of assistance caused his death and seeks damages for compensatory, survival, and wrongful death claims, with an initial pretrial conference scheduled for July 17, 2026.

United Airlines Flight Evacuated After Skidding Off Runway at Bush Airport

A United Airlines flight from Memphis rolled onto the grass while exiting onto the taxiway at Houston's George Bush Intercontinental Airport, causing the plane to tilt to the side. All 160 passengers and six crew members were safely evacuated, and no injuries were reported. The FAA will be investigating the incident, and United Airlines will be working with relevant authorities to understand what happened.
